Three authors reveal the obscure corners of the occult. In LeFanu's Dickon the Devil the narrator discovers that the sinister ghosts of the past have never left Barwyke Hall. Rudyard Kipling tells the story of a man who disappears mysteriously. In Hawthorne's The Minister's Black Veil, the Puritan Reverend Hooper is plagued by a terrible secret sin that forces him to wear a black veil. |

The Legend of Slappy Hooper is an American tall tale, which originally appeared in print as part of a WPA-sponsored collection. Slappy, "the world's biggest, fastest, bestest sign painter," has an oversize problem: the signs he creates are too darn lifelike. His picture of a rose attracts bees, while a sign featuring a hot summer sun melts snow. One catastrophe follows another, until Slappy paints himself out of a job. On the verge of chucking his paint kit into the river, the despairing hero is approached by Michael, from the Heavenly Sign Company, and hired to paint the world's sunrises and sunsets. |
